General Info
In Block
cec32a45bfe82bb344575e5ee3065498ffe3414622958da5f8f36e194157541d
In block height
Total Input
3526097.15504351 RDD
Total Output
3526097.15504351 RDD
Transaction Details
Fee
0 RDD
mined Fri, 06 Feb 2015 10:20:33 UTC
From
3526097.15504351 RDD